机器视觉训练数据的选择与准备艺术
数据集的构成
在进行机器视觉训练时,高质量的训练数据是至关重要的。一个好的数据集不仅需要包含多样化且有代表性的图像,还要确保这些图像能够覆盖到所需识别或分类的所有可能情况。例如,在设计一个用于物体检测任务的模型时,我们需要收集各种各样的物体图片,并确保每个类别都有足够数量和多样性以支持模型学习。
图像预处理技术
接收到的原始图像是通常经过一系列复杂过程拍摄而成,这些过程包括光照变化、对比度调整、噪声干扰等。此外,实际应用中会遇到尺寸大小不同的问题,因此在进行机器视觉训练之前,对输入图像进行标准化处理是非常必要的一步。这包括但不限于调整尺寸、归一化颜色通道值以及去除背景噪声等操作,以此来提高模型性能并减少过拟合风险。
数据增强策略
为了增加数据量并降低模型过拟合现象,我们可以采用不同的数据增强策略,如旋转、缩放变换、裁剪和翻转等方法。通过这些手段,可以创造出更多新的样本,从而为神经网络提供更广泛范围内的情景信息,使得它能更好地适应新环境中的挑战。在某些情况下,甚至可以将同一张图片反复变换后作为多个独立样本加入训练集中,以此来提高网络鲁棒性。
实验验证与迭代优化
实验验证阶段是一个关键环节,它涉及到对不同的算法组合和参数设置进行测试,以及评估它们在特定任务上的表现。通过实验我们可以发现哪些因素对最终结果影响最大,然后根据这个知识点进一步优化我们的模型。这通常涉及到大量迭代尝试,比如调整深度学习框架中的超参数或者改变网络结构直至达到最佳效果。
持续更新与适应性提升
最后,不断更新和扩充我们的数据集对于保持系统最新也是必不可少的一部分。不断进口新的、高质量的标注数据,并不断地从用户反馈中吸取经验教训,为系统升级提供依据,同时也能让算法逐渐变得更加智能,以适应不断变化的人工智能领域需求。如果说一次成功只是完成了第一轮比赛,那么持续创新则是在赛场上永远领先一步。在这个快速发展的时代,只有不断革新才能保持竞争力。